Hi! SSIS‑950 refers to SQL Server Integration Services (SSIS), not VisualCron itself. It’s used for ETL workflows, and the “950” likely refers to a specific package or implementation.

You can integrate SSIS with VisualCron by creating a job that runs an SSIS package via dtexec.exe on a schedule. This gives you VisualCron’s automation and logging along with SSIS data flows.
